MEMORANDUM OPINION
On July 18, 2007, this court delivered an opinion conditionally granting the petition for writ of mandamus filed by Dawn McKillip-Odom as relator. That opinion ordered Respondent, the Honorable Joe Bob Golden, Judge of the 273rd Judicial District Court, San Augustine County, Texas, to vacate his order dated May 11, 2007 granting the Coxen plaintiffs’ motion to sever and enter an order denying the motion. Subsequently, on August 1, 2007, Respondent signed an order complying with this court’s order and opinion of July 18, 2007.
All issues attendant to this original proceeding having been disposed of, this mandamus proceeding has now been rendered moot; therefore, the writ need not issue. Accordingly, this original proceeding is dismissed.
